Backblaze is the object storage leader in the open cloud movement, fueling customer success with cloud storage built purposefully to unlock budgets, unburden administrators, and unleash innovators. Together with our partners, we’re helping customers break free from the restrictive, overpriced legacy solutions that hold them back, and blaze forward with the full power of the open cloud in their hands.

Founded in 2007, we scaled the business with less than $3 million in outside funding until 2021, when we did a traditional IPO on the Nasdaq stock exchange. Today, Backblaze generates over $100m in revenue and is the leading specialized storage cloud - managing over three billion gigabytes of data storage for 500K+ customers in 175+ countries, including businesses, developers, IT professionals, and individuals.

About the Role

~1 min read

This is a ground-floor developer relations role at a company that is serious about building a DevRel function — not just checking a box. You’ll be the technical voice of Backblaze: creating content, showing up at events, and helping developers understand how to build with Backblaze B2 in the workloads they’re actually running — AI pipelines, media workflows, and data-intensive infrastructure.

You’ll work directly with our Director of Startup & Developer Relations and alongside the Flamethrower Startup Program — Backblaze’s initiative to become the storage layer of choice for early-stage companies. You’ll have support from our product, content, documentation and other teams, as well as consulting budget for structural and strategic scaffolding as we build this out. Your job is to be technically credible, well-connected, and visible.

The right person for this role has been doing this work informally — writing technical content, showing up at conferences, building a following in developer communities — and is ready to make it the job. Or they’ve been doing it formally at the mid-level and want to step up on impact without stepping into program leadership yet.

Responsibilities

~1 min read
  • Create technical content that teaches developers how to build with Backblaze B2: tutorials, sample applications, reference architectures, blog posts, and short-form video
  • Build and publish working code examples and demos — especially for AI/ML workflows (training data pipelines, model artifact storage, inference infrastructure), media workflows, and application storage
  • Contribute to and improve developer documentation, SDKs, and quickstart guides
  • Translate what you’re hearing from developers into actionable product feedback for Engineering and Product
  • Be genuinely present in the developer communities where our users live — social media, Discord, Slack, GitHub, and elsewhere
  • Represent Backblaze at developer events: speak, demo, show up, and be worth talking to. We attend conferences across AI/ML, media, cloud infrastructure, and startup ecosystems
  • Build relationships in the AI/ML, media, and cloud infrastructure developer communities that generate inbound awareness for Backblaze
  • Support Flamethrower startup cohort members in getting to production faster — answer technical questions, sanity-check architectures, and document patterns worth sharing broadly
  • Work closely with the Director of Startup & Developer Relations, as well as our product team, lifecycle marketing, and product marketing to identify common technical blockers and create content that removes them
  • Partner with Marketing on ecosystem storytelling, technical blog strategy, and developer-facing content
  • Maintain a consistent feedback loop from developers to Product — surface friction points, integration gaps, and unmet needs
  • 4–7 years of hands-on experience as a software developer or engineer, with meaningful time working with cloud infrastructure and object storage (S3, B2, GCS, or equivalent)
  • Direct experience building or integrating AI/ML workflows that involve storage — training data pipelines, model artifact management, inference infrastructure, or similar workloads
  • You write working code. You may use AI tools to accelerate it — but you understand what you’re shipping and can explain it to another developer
  • An established presence in developer communities — a social following, conference talks, a technical blog, open source contributions, or some combination. We’re not counting followers; we’re looking for signal that you show up and people pay attention
  • Strong written communication: you can write a clear technical tutorial and a crisp internal summary with equal ease
  • Self-directed — you don’t need a content calendar handed to you to know what to build next

Nice to Have

~1 min read
  • Familiarity with Backblaze B2 or direct experience with object storage in production environments
  • Experience with media/video workflows, SaaS backend architecture, or data-intensive platform development
  • Prior experience in a formal DevRel capacity — developer advocate, technical evangelist, developer educator — even if it wasn’t your primary title
  • Active in the AI/ML developer ecosystem: Hugging Face, Discord communities, GitHub, X/Twitter, YouTube, or similar channels
